serological evidence for tick-borne encephalitis, borreliosis, and human granulocytic anaplasmosis in mongolia.five hundred and forty-five serum samples from donors from various parts of mongolia were investigated for antibodies against the tick-borne encephalitis (tbe) virus, borrelia burgdorferi, and anaplasma phagocytophilum. seroprevalence against tbe was 5.1% in the province of selenge and 0.9% in bulgan province, seroprevalence against b. burgdorferi was 1.9% in selenge province and bulgan province, 13.9% in dornogov province, and 3.0% in tov province and ulaanbaatar. seroprevalence against a. phag ...200616524782
high prevalence of genetically diverse borrelia bavariensis-like strains in ixodes persulcatus from selenge aimag, mongolia.in mongolia, lyme borreliosis was first reported in 2003. to determine which borrelia species may contribute to the occurrence of lyme borreliosis in mongolia, real-time pcr was conducted on 372 adult ixodes persulcatus ticks collected in selenge aimag, the province with the highest incidence of human lyme borreliosis. 24.5% of ticks were identified to be positive for borrelia burgdorferi sensu lato dna. species differentiation using an snp-based real-time pcr and multi-locus sequence analysis r ...201323084366
pcr detection of anaplasma phagocytophilum and borrelia burgdorferi in ixodes persulcatus ticks in mongolia.a molecular epidemiological survey was conducted to identify the tick-borne disease agents anaplasma phagocytophilum and borrelia burgdorferi sensu lato in selenge province, mongolia. the survey was in response to a suspected a. phagocytophilum infection in a patient. in 2012, a total of 129 questing ixodes persulcatus adult ticks were sampled by flagging vegetation. a. phagocytophilum and borrelia spp. were detected by pcr, targeting the 16s rdna (rrs) and 5s-23s intergenic spacer region, respe ...201424451102
